Output e51d9f6a61c6af34a0a4d47396ef673d38be9f63ca486e75f1df51e87f755c60:0

value
80683117
script pubkey
OP_HASH160 OP_PUSHBYTES_20 25363396d7affad05ef5e937c884b47f58ac3781 OP_EQUAL
address
MBHvAWreVVKyd4cz1KZcNCommVeo3hcP94
transaction
e51d9f6a61c6af34a0a4d47396ef673d38be9f63ca486e75f1df51e87f755c60
spent
true